Sourdough to be a Nutritional Powerhouse
Sourdough bread, in contrast, is often celebrated for its nutritional Rewards. Designed via a natural fermentation procedure, sourdough has a reduce glycemic index as compared to other breads, meaning it has a slower impact on blood sugar ranges. This causes it to be an improved choice for keeping Strength stages all through the faculty day.

Moreover, the fermentation approach in sourdough breaks down several of the gluten and phytic acid inside the flour, making it easier to digest and maximizing the bioavailability of nutrients like magnesium, iron, and zinc. This positions sourdough being a nutritious option for school foods, notably when designed with total grains.

The Accessibility of Sourdough: Cost and Planning Problems
Although sourdough offers various overall health Advantages, its integration into university meals courses is not really devoid of problems. 1 sizeable barrier is Expense. Sourdough bread, significantly when manufactured with high-excellent, organic components, is often more expensive than commercially made bread. This causes it to be difficult for educational institutions, especially Individuals with minimal budgets, to provide sourdough on a regular basis.

Another challenge is preparation. Sourdough requires a more time fermentation process, which may be tough to handle in a faculty kitchen. Some universities have tackled this by partnering with area bakeries, but this Alternative might not be feasible in all places.
